Description:
Origins and insertions of the laryngeal muscles. In this image, the anatomy of the laryngeal muscles can be appreciated. The origins are marked with a circle, and the end of the line marks the insertion of the muscle. English labels. Retrieved from the interactive module Anatomy of swallowing (Deglutition) from the website Clinical Anatomy of the University of British Columbia.
